Couches For Sale UK How do you pick the right couch? It's worth doing some research to find the perfect sofa for your needs. This includes not just looking at the design, fabric, and size, but also how you intend to utilize it. For example, if you have pets, consider how much wear and wear your sofa will experience over time. You might want to select fabrics that resist stains and spills or leather finishes that are easy to clean. Another thing to consider is the space you have to place your sofa in. In a showroom, it's easy to pick a big chaise lounge but at home, the couch could make your room feel cramped. That's why it's important to measure your space accurately before you buy. Before you purchase a sofa, be sure to check the policy on returns and delivery options. It is important to know if the brand will facilitate second-floor deliveries or door frames with wide doors and you may have to factor in a lead time while the sofa is being constructed. When you are looking to purchase a sofa, it's worth thinking about the frame material and upholstery. A solid wooden frame can last for a long time and appear better with age, while an engineered wooden frame will save you money while continuing to be durable. You should also think about what you'll be using the sofa for and decide on whether you need a cushion padding that is reversible, which can help prolong the life of your sofa. Don't forget to examine the warranty of your sofa. A good warranty will give you assurance that something goes wrong with your sofa in the future, however an inadequate one could result in a broken piece of furniture with no money back. You're better off paying by credit card than cash or by check, since you're protected under the Consumer Credit Act. What should you look for in a couch? If you purchase a sofa with a fabric upholstery, choose a sturdy, thickly weaved fabric that can withstand regular use. Fabrics with a rub-count of at least 100,000 are more robust. If you have children or pets pick fabrics that are easy to clean and stain-resistant. Nicole Crowder, an upholsterer and furniture designer, suggests fabrics with a tight weave such as velvet, linen, or cotton-linen mixtures, for their durability. Also consider the depth and height of the seat backs. If you suffer from back problems pick a sofa that has high backs to provide support. Select chairs that are wide and comfortable for two or more people. The couch's frame is another important factor. Avoid frames composed of particle board and cardboard, as they are fragile and susceptible to twisting. Make sure the spring system is strong. Springs that are sinuous or coil have a shorter lifespan, while hand-tied and coil springs are stronger and last longer.
